Minutes — Management Meeting, Loyalty Overhaul

Present: Mira, Josten, Fell. For the incoming director's benefit: we agreed to retire the old Starpoints scheme and replace it with tiered credits under the working name Orbit. Redemption costs were running hot, so Orbit caps annual accrual. Josten will draft member comms; Fell handles the systems migration estimate. Launch pencilled for spring. The commercial intent driving the overhaul is recorded below.

board note of bawip-kawef: Headcount on the Quenwyn team goes from 3 to 80 by the end of April. Gross margin on Quenwyn came in at 5 percent against a plan of 15 percent.

Minutes — Management Meeting, Project Larkvale Review

Attendees reviewed the delayed rollout of the Larkvale scheduling platform. Delivery has slipped two quarters due to integration issues with the Brontide ledger system. Marta Q. confirmed vendor Hexfell Systems will supply a revised build by month-end. Branch managers should continue manual scheduling until further notice and flag staffing gaps early. Budget impact is contained within the contingency reserve. The steering group will brief branches on the revised business direction below.

board note of kageg-bahof: The renewal with Holwynax Holdings closes at $2 million a year, 5 percent below the last contract. Project Ulaath slips by two quarters because of the supplier delay.

# Heads up, new folks: this env file drives the circuit breaker for the Quellport upstream API.
# If Quellport starts timing out, the breaker trips after five consecutive failures and holds open
# for ninety seconds before half-open probes resume. Don't crank the thresholds without pinging
# the platform channel first — we learned that the hard way during the Marwick launch.
# The breaker's health-probe endpoint requires an auth token, which must be set on the very next line.

vault entry, yahif-yajep: COURIER_KEY29=b802bdf8034096b65a51c6ba5abe2